1. Ingredients (serves 2):
-
2 cups fresh or frozen pineapple chunks
-
1 medium banana (fresh or frozen, for creaminess)
-
¾ cup plain or vanilla yogurt (or coconut yogurt for a tropical twist)
-
½ cup orange juice (or coconut water for lighter flavor)
-
1 tbsp honey or maple syrup (optional, if pineapple is not very sweet)
-
3–4 ice cubes (if using fresh pineapple)
-
Fresh mint leaves, for garnish (optional)

3. Method:
-
Prepare Ingredients: Peel and chop pineapple and banana. If using frozen, no need to thaw.
-
Blend Smoothie: Place pineapple, banana, yogurt, orange juice (or coconut water), honey, and ice into a blender. Blend until smooth and creamy.
-
Taste and Adjust: If you prefer a thinner smoothie, add more juice or coconut water. For extra sweetness, add more honey.
-
Serve: Pour into tall glasses, garnish with fresh mint leaves or a pineapple wedge, and serve immediately.

5. Extra Tips:
-
For a tropical upgrade, use coconut milk instead of yogurt and juice.
-
Add a handful of spinach or kale for a green nutrient boost—the pineapple masks the flavor.
-
Toss in 1 tbsp chia seeds or flax seeds for added fiber and omega-3s.
-
Freeze leftovers into popsicle molds for a refreshing summer treat.
